I upgraded to Windows 11, and a day later I lost the ability to use wi-fi and bluetooth. I can only connect to the internet using an ethernet cord. (My wi-fi in my house is fine, I can connect all my other devices).  I have been trying days to fix this to no avail.

This is what I have done so far that has not fixed the problem:

- Restarted computer, then also turned computer off for 10 minutes and back on

- Reset wi-fi and turned it on & Off (for those who will inevitably ask me)

- Reset adapters

- Updated wi-fi driver

- Uninstalled wi-fi driver, and installed latest wi-fi driver from HP 

- Reset Winsock Catalog

- Troubleshoot network adapters (with ethernet connected AND with ethernet not connected)

- Troubleshoot hardware & firmware

- Did a hard reset, wiped all apps and went back to Windows 10

- Did all the above steps after going back to Windows 10

Please download and install the 3rd one on the following list

 

          https://www.intel.com.au/content/www/au/en/products/sku/130293/intel-wifi-6-ax201-gig/downloads.html

 

If still problem, you may have to do a clean install.

 

(a) Go to Device Manager to uninstall existing wifi driver,

(b) Reboot machine,

(c) Right click the downloaded file and select Run as administrator,

(d) Reboot again.
